Thirty five athletes, Ukhanyo’s principal and deputy, 20 staff members and 12 coaches descended onto Zwaanswyk school for the zonal athletics meeting in the south of Cape Town. There were 18 schools competing and Ukhanyo was placed 4th. A particularly good result. Seven athletes were chosen to go through to the next athletics trials meeting.
Imyoli Ndabambi, Linathi Ntangenkabi and Ayoli Magidigidi came first, second and third in the under-11 12 000-meter race. What an achievement! We entered the shot put for the first time and Uminathis Senedenqi made it through to the next round.
The school staff and coaches worked so hard each day after school preparing the children for the race. That and the recent triangular athletics meeting at Fish Hoek Primary prepared our team so well.
The Ingrid Wheeler field again allowed the athletes to practice at school.
